How much money is in Joe's savings account after 3 years if he deposited $400 at the beginning of the year and the account pays

4% annual simple interest?

Answer:

Total amount in Joe's savings account T = $448

Step-by-step explanation:

Given;

time t = 3 years

Annual rate r = 4%

Principal P = $400

Simple interest can be expressed as;

I = Prt/100

Substituting the given values;

I =400×4×3/100 = 4800/100

I = $48

Total amount in account T;

T = P + I = $400 + $48 = $448

Answer:

$448

Step-by-step explanation:

To calculate Joe's savings, we can use the formula for simple interest:

P = Po*(1+r*t)

Where P is the final value, Po is the inicial value, r is the interest and t is the time in years.

So, In our problem, we have that Po = 400, r = 4% and t = 3, then we can find P:

P = 400*(1+0.04*3)

P = 400*1.12 = $448

Joe has $448 in his savings.

Given the parent function f(x) = 8x + 9, rewrite the function after the following transformation: reflect over the x-axis. Group
kari74 [83]

Given:

The parent function is

f(x)=8x+9

To find:

The function after the reflection over the x-axis.

Solution:

We know that, if a function f(x) reflected over x-axis to get the function g(x), then

g(x)=-f(x)

Putting f(x)=8x+9, we get

g(x)=-(8x+9)

g(x)=-8x-9

The function after the reflection over the x-axis is g(x)=-8x-9.
